WebOct 3, 2024 · A glute bridge is a body-weight exercise that primarily targets the glutes, and is popular in both strength-training and yoga circles. You do it lying down on your back with your knees bent and feet flat on the floor. Then you lift your hips toward the ceiling until your torso forms a diagonal line from your knees to your neck. There's not much difference between the Kas glute bridge vs. hip thrust setup — your shoulder blades are resting on a bench and you lift your hips toward the ceiling — but the Kas glute bridge involves a smaller range of motion and amount of power, says Summers.
